## Sensor drift: what to do at 3am

If the GrowLoop controller starts reporting humidity swings that don't match the backup probes in the Fernwick greenhouse, it's almost always sensor drift, not an actual climate event. Don't panic and don't touch the vents manually. First, restart the calibration daemon and give it ten minutes to re-baseline. If readings still disagree by more than 5%, flip the controller into safe mode. The safe-mode thresholds it will use are these.

config for yahap-bajof:
[istix]
host = istix.qorvelsys.internal
user = istix_svc
database = istix_prod

## Action Item: Sample Routing-Service Logs

During the incident, the Wayfinder routing service emitted ~40k log lines per second, saturating the ingest pipeline and delaying alerts. We will add head-based sampling at the emitter with full retention for error-level events. Reviewers should verify the sampler is applied before serialization. The proposed sampling constants are as follows.

tuning table, yajog-yahof:
BUDGETS = {
    "lamvan": 303,
    "wenox": 460,
    "fenvan": 525,
}

Handover note — FareSpindle rules engine

From Odile to Brant's crew: the shipping-fee rules evaluate top-down, first match wins. Don't reorder rules without rerunning the Tarnwick regression set. Overrides for oversized freight live in a separate bundle and load at startup. The staging instance currently runs with the following configuration values.

service settings:
PRAIX_LOG_LEVEL=error
PRAIX_METRICS_HOST=metrics.praix.qorvelcorp.corp
PRAIX_POOL_SIZE=16

# Reminder job for the Willowmere clinic scheduler.
#
# This runs hourly and nudges patients ahead of appointments. Be gentle
# when tweaking things — the SMS gateway rate-limits us hard, and the
# retry window has to stay shorter than the send interval or you'll
# double-text people (we learned that the fun way). Current tuning
# values live right here.

constants for bawif-kawif:
QUOTAS = {
    "ulaael": 5,
    "holael": 10,
}